Red Carpet Dock Reception to Welcome Disney Star 36’ Motor Lifeboat 36460
The Michigan Maritime Museum is thrilled to be welcoming the star of the Disney film The Finest Hours, the 36-foot motor lifeboat 36460. In true Hollywood fashion, there will be a red carpet dock reception at the Museum July 9, 2016 from 2pm-5pm. Revelers can take part in the patriotic fanfare and fun at the reception with music, flag waving, and food all available on our campus. See the boat up close and personal at our docks. Meet the owner of the boat, Jeff Shook as well as the person largely responsible for its restoration, George Powell. Hear Powell describe his experiences with the process of restoration as well as Shook’s work with Disney on the set of The Finest Hours, including teaching the actors how to operate the boat! The 36460 will be escorted into South Haven by the United States Coast Guard St. Joseph Station 46-foot rescue boat and a flotilla of USCG Auxiliary vessels. If other boaters are interested in following the escort into port, boats will be organized by the Coast Guard Auxiliary three miles north of South Haven (near Sleepy Hollow) at 1:30pm on the 9th.
The event is free and the Museum is waiving admission fees between 2pm and 5pm. Bring the whole family to the event and join us for a celebration of the arrival of this famous boat that will be on a long-term loan to the Museum.
